int main(int argc, char *argv[0]) {
int main(int argc, char** argv)
das ist nicht ein zeiger auf char-arrays der länge 0
Ich schrieb intuitiv "while (*argv)". Aber was genau bedeutet das technisch, bzw warum funktioniert das so.
argv[argc] ist immer NULL. das ist aber überflüssig, da du zusätzlich über argc iterierst, bzw. ist das überflüssig
Weiters ist mir eines auch nicht ganz klar. Statt *(*(argv))++ kann ich nicht **argv++ schreiben
http://www.google.de/search?q=operator+precedence